At the farthest edge of a forgotten village, an old woman lives alone in a house everyone avoids.
When she accidentally swallows a fly, it should be nothing more than a moment's disgust. Instead, something begins moving beneath her ribs.
Convinced nature can correct the mistake, she reaches for the creature that catches a fly. Then the creature that catches that. With every desperate remedy, the corruption grows. Flesh reshapes. Animals disappear. The house itself begins to listen.
As strange sounds drift from the bend in the road and livestock vanish from the fields, Marta Keel finds herself drawn toward the woman she once owed a debt. What waits inside the house is no sickness, no curse, and no creature anyone was meant to understand.
The Hollow Woman's Rhyme is a folk-horror novella of transformation, isolation, eldritch terror, and the stories communities tell when faced with the impossible.

E. C. Thornley writes horror fiction inspired by folklore, cosmic horror, body horror, and the unsettling stories that linger long after they are told.
Influenced by nursery rhymes, forgotten legends, and classic horror, he enjoys creating stories where the familiar slowly becomes something impossible.
The Hollow Woman's Rhyme is his debut novella.
